Exhibit 9.2 FIRST AMENDMENT TO INVESTORS' AGREEMENT This First Amendment to Investor Agreement ("First Amendment") is entered into as of February 23, 1999, by and among the following: Communities Investor Corp., a Delaware corporation (the "CIC") and each of the stockholders of CIC identified as such on Schedule A hereto (each of whom is referred to individually as a "CIC Stockholder" and collectively as the "CIC Stockholders"). Communities Investor Limited Partnership, a Delaware limited partnership ("CILP") and each of the limited partners of CILP identified as such on Schedule A hereto (each of whom is referred to individually as a "CILP Limited Partner" and collectively as the "CILP Limited Partners"). Watermark Communities, Inc., formerly known as D & A Communities, Inc., a Delaware corporation ("Watermark") and each of the stockholders of Watermark identified as such on Schedule A hereto (each of whom is referred to individually as a "Watermark Stockholder" and collectively as the "Watermark Stockholders"). BankBoston, N.A., as Agent and SFT II, Inc. (together with any successors and assigns, individually a "Lender" and collectively the "Lenders"). References herein to the CIC Stockholders, the CILP Limited Partners, the Watermark Stockholders and the Lenders include their respective Permitted Transferees (as defined below). RECITALS: The parties entered into an Investors' Agreement dated November 30, 1998 under which they agreed among other things, to certain voting agreements, including the election of up to 7 directors for Watermark and to certain management controls, including a requirement that all subsidiaries of Watermark would have the same board of directors as Watermark. The parties now wish to provide for (i) the election of up to 9 directors and (ii) those certain subsidiaries which must have the same board of directors as Watermark and to make certain conforming changes. NOW THEREFORE, in consideration of the premises and mutual covenants hereinafter contained, the parties hereto agree as follows. 1. Section 7.1 (a) is deleted and the following Section 7.1(a) is substituted therefor: "(a) A Watermark Board of not less than 5 members and not more than 9 members," 2. Section 7.1(b)(vi) is deleted and the following Section 7.1(b)(vi) is substituted therefor:

"(vi) Up to four directors designated by a majority of the persons referred to in paragraphs (i) through (v) above, except as provided in Section 7.1(c). 3. Section 7.1(d) is deleted and the following Section 7.1(d) is substituted therefor: "(d) The composition of the board of directors of Newco's operating subsidiaries which are substantial corporate divisions or a substantial portion of Newco's business, including, but not limited to, Investors of WCI, Inc., Florida Design Communities, Inc. and Bay Colony-Gateway, Inc., (each such board, a 'Sub Board") shall be the same as that of the Newco Board. The decision of at least three of the holders of a majority of the Bishop Interests, CVC Interests, MacArthur Interest and the Management Interests shall control any question as to whether a Newco subsidiary is governed by this Section 7.1(d)." 4. Section 7.1)f) is deleted and the following Section 7.1(f) is substituted therefor: "(f) Any directors designated under Section 7.1(b)(i) through (v) or Section 7.1(c) shall be removed from the Newco Board, a Sub Board or any committee thereof (with or without cause) only at the written request of the Equity Owner or a majority of the Equity Owners which have the right to designate such director hereunder, but only upon such written request and under no other circumstances (in each applicable case, determined on the basis of a vote or consent of the relevant Equity Owners). Any director designated under Section 7.1(b)(vi) may be removed from the Newco Board, a Sub Board or any committee thereof (with or without cause) at any time upon the concurrence of at least three of the holders of a majority of the Bishop Interests, CVC Interests, MacArthur Interests and the Management Partners as described in Section 7.3, and the Equity Owners of Newco agree to vote all Interests in Newco to remove such directors." 5. Section 7.1(k) is added as follows: "(k) Each Equity Owner shall vote all Interests over which such Equity Owner has voting control, and shall take all other necessary or desirable actions within such Equity Owner's control and Newco shall take all necessary and desirable actions within its control so as (x) to fill any vacancy created in the directorship seat under Sections 7.1(b)(i) through (v) with a replacement designated in accordance with the applicable paragraph (i) through (v) and (y) to fill any vacancy created in a directorship seat under Section 7.1(b)(vi) with a successor to the extent designated by the appropriate directors thereunder. 6. Sections 7.3(k) and 7.3(l) are added as follows: "(k) Removal in accordance with Section 7.1 (f) of any director who was designated to serve under Section 7.1(b)(vi). (l) Election of any individual to a directorship seat referred to in Section 7.1(b)(vi) of this Agreement." 2

7. Ratification. Except as amended by this First Amendment, the Investors' Agreement is hereby ratified and confirmed and shall remain in full force and effect. 8. Counterparts. This Agreement may be executed in two (2) or more counterparts and each counterpart shall be deemed to be an original and which counterparts together shall constitute one and the same agreement of the parties. 9. Section Headings. Headings contained in this Agreement are inserted only as a matter of convenience and in no way define, limit or extend the scope or intent of this Agreement or any provision hereof.
